Defining Success in Car Insurance Lawsuits

Winning a car insurance lawsuit isn’t simply about getting a payout; it’s about achieving fair compensation for your injuries, losses, and suffering after a car accident. This means securing the financial resources needed to cover medical bills, lost wages, property damage, and pain and suffering. The definition of success varies greatly depending on the individual circumstances of each case.

Successful Car Insurance Lawsuit Outcomes

Successful outcomes in car insurance lawsuits can manifest in several ways. A complete victory might involve a jury awarding the full amount of damages claimed, while a more nuanced success could be a negotiated settlement that covers the majority of the plaintiff’s losses. For example, a successful outcome might be a settlement of $50,000 to cover medical expenses, lost income, and pain and suffering resulting from a rear-end collision, or a court judgment awarding $100,000 for a serious injury caused by a drunk driver.

The key is that the settlement or judgment provides sufficient compensation for the harm suffered.

Average Settlement Amounts for Car Accident Claims

Average settlement amounts vary significantly depending on the severity of the injuries and the extent of the damages. Minor accidents resulting in whiplash might settle for a few thousand dollars, while severe injuries like broken bones or traumatic brain injuries could result in settlements or judgments in the hundreds of thousands, or even millions, of dollars. Statistics from the Insurance Information Institute or similar organizations could provide a general range, but these are averages and individual cases will always differ greatly.

For instance, a fender bender might average a $5,000 settlement, while a case involving a fatality could reach settlements exceeding $1 million, depending on various factors including jurisdiction and liability.

Factors Influencing Success Rate of Car Insurance Lawsuits

Several factors significantly influence the success rate of car insurance lawsuits. Strong evidence, including police reports, witness testimonies, medical records, and photographic evidence, is crucial. The severity of the injuries directly impacts the potential settlement amount. Clear liability, where the at-fault driver’s negligence is indisputable, greatly increases the chances of a favorable outcome. Furthermore, the skill and experience of the legal team representing the plaintiff play a vital role in achieving a successful resolution.

Finally, the insurance company’s willingness to negotiate fairly also affects the outcome.

Comparison of Successful vs. Unsuccessful Cases

Factor Successful Case Unsuccessful Case
Evidence Strong evidence, including medical records, police report, witness statements, photos Weak or insufficient evidence, conflicting accounts
Injury Severity Significant injuries requiring extensive medical treatment and resulting in long-term disability Minor injuries requiring minimal medical care and no lasting effects
Liability Clear liability; other driver’s negligence is evident Contested liability; multiple parties involved or unclear fault
Legal Representation Experienced and skilled attorney Inadequate legal representation or self-representation

Factors Affecting Lawyer Success Rate

Car insurance lawyer success rate and client testimonials

Winning a car insurance lawsuit hinges on several crucial factors, extending beyond mere legal knowledge. A lawyer’s success rate is a complex interplay of experience, strategy, negotiation prowess, and investigative thoroughness. Understanding these elements is key to choosing the right legal representation.

Legal Experience and Case Outcomes

Years of practice significantly impact a lawyer’s ability to handle car insurance cases effectively. Experienced lawyers possess a deep understanding of insurance company tactics, legal precedents, and the intricacies of personal injury law. This translates to a better ability to anticipate challenges, build stronger cases, and negotiate favorable settlements. For instance, a seasoned lawyer might immediately recognize weaknesses in the opposing party’s arguments based on their extensive experience with similar cases, leading to a more efficient and successful resolution.

Conversely, a less experienced lawyer might struggle to navigate the complexities of the legal process, potentially leading to missed opportunities or unfavorable outcomes. The depth of their experience in handling similar cases directly correlates with their ability to predict outcomes and strategize accordingly.

Legal Strategies in Car Insurance Lawsuits

Various legal strategies can be employed in car insurance lawsuits. Some lawyers might prioritize aggressive litigation, aiming for a trial to maximize potential compensation. Others may focus on swift negotiation and settlement, aiming for a quicker resolution. The choice of strategy depends on factors such as the strength of the evidence, the client’s preferences, and the specific circumstances of the case.

For example, a case with strong photographic and witness evidence might lend itself to a more aggressive approach, while a case with weaker evidence might necessitate a more conciliatory strategy focused on a negotiated settlement. A successful lawyer will adapt their strategy to the specific details of each case.

Effective Negotiation Skills and Settlement Amounts

Negotiation is paramount in car insurance cases. Skilled negotiators can secure significantly higher settlements than lawyers with weaker negotiation abilities. This involves understanding the insurance company’s perspective, presenting a compelling case, and strategically leveraging available evidence to achieve the best possible outcome for their client. A skilled negotiator might successfully argue for a higher settlement by highlighting the severity of the client’s injuries, the long-term impact of the accident, and the extent of their incurred medical expenses.

The difference between a skilled and unskilled negotiator can result in thousands, even tens of thousands, of dollars in the final settlement amount.

Thorough Investigation and Evidence Gathering

A thorough investigation is the cornerstone of any successful car insurance lawsuit. This involves meticulously gathering evidence such as police reports, medical records, witness statements, and photographs of the accident scene. The quality and completeness of this evidence directly impact the strength of the case and the potential for a favorable outcome. A lawyer who fails to thoroughly investigate the case might miss crucial evidence, weakening their position and potentially leading to a less favorable settlement or a loss at trial.

For example, overlooking a crucial witness statement or failing to obtain critical medical documentation could significantly hinder the success of the case.

Insurance Company Tactics and Case Outcomes

Insurance companies often employ various tactics to minimize payouts. These can include delaying investigations, questioning the validity of claims, and offering low initial settlements. Understanding these tactics is crucial for a successful outcome. For example, insurance adjusters might attempt to pressure clients into accepting quick settlements before all medical treatment is complete. The Role of Online Reviews and Ratings in Building Client Trust

Online reviews and ratings play a significant role in shaping potential clients’ perceptions of a car insurance lawyer. Positive reviews act as social proof, demonstrating the lawyer’s competence and the positive experiences of past clients. Platforms like Google My Business, Yelp, and Avvo are crucial for collecting and showcasing these reviews. Actively encouraging satisfied clients to leave reviews can significantly boost the lawyer’s online reputation and build trust with potential clients who often rely heavily on these reviews before making a decision.

Responding to both positive and negative reviews demonstrates transparency and commitment to client satisfaction, further solidifying credibility.
